Richard Nelson's plays include Illyria,The Gabriel Plays (Women Of A Certain AgeWhat Did You Expect?Hungry), OblivionNikolai And The OthersThe Apple Family Plays (That Hopey Changey ThingSweet And SadRegular Singing), Farewell To The TheatreConversations In Tusculum,  Frank’s HomeHow Shakespeare Won The WestRodney's WifeFranny's WayMadame MelvilleGoodnight Children Everywhere (Olivier Award Best Play), The General From AmericaNew EnglandTwo Shakespearean Actors (Tony Nomination, Best Play), Some Americans Abroad (Olivier Nomination, Best Comedy), and others. His musicals include James Joyce’s The Dead (with Shaun Davey, Tony Award Best Book of a Musical), and My Life With Albertine (with Ricky Ian Gordon). He has adapted and/or translated numerous classical and contemporary plays; his films include Hyde Park On Hudson (Roger Michell, director, Focus Features), Ethan Frome (Miramax Films) and Sensibility And Sense (American Playhouse).  He is an honorary associate artist of the Royal Shakespeare Company, a recipient of the Academy Award in Literature from the American Academy of Arts and Letters, and the PEN/Laura Pels “Master Playwright” Award.
